How Our Basement Water Removal Process Works
Don’t let water damage ruin your home. Our team follows a proven process to ensure your basement is dry and safe in no time. We start by assessing the damage, identifying the source of the water, and developing a customized plan to extract the water and dry the area.
Step 1: Assess and Identify
We send a certified technician to your home to assess the damage and identify the source of the water. This expert will use specialized equipment to find out the extent of the damage and develop a plan to extract the water and dry the area within 60 minutes of arrival.
Step 2: Extract the Water
Next, our technician will extract the water from your basement using specialized equipment, such as truck-mounted pumps and wet/dry vacuums. This step is crucial in preventing further damage and ensuring your home is safe to return to as soon as possible.
Step 3: Dry the Area
Once the water has been extracted, our technician will use specialized equipment to dry the area, including air movers and dehumidifiers. This step is critical in preventing mold growth and ensuring your home is safe and healthy for you and your family.
Step 4: Sanitize and Disinfect
Finally, our technician will sanitize and disinfect the area to prevent the growth of mold and mildew. This step is essential in ensuring your home is healthy and safe for you and your family to enjoy for years to come.
Step 5: Follow-up and Prevention
Our team will follow up with you to ensure that your home is safe and healthy. We’ll also provide you with customized solutions to prevent future water issues, including recommendations for waterproofing and drainage systems to protect your home for years to come.

Basement Water Removal Cost In Elk River, MN
The cost of basement water removal varies dep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and the local conditions in your neighborhood. Here are some estimated price ranges for common basement water removal services: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Emergency Water Removal | $500 – $2,500 | The sever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and the local conditions in your neighborhood. |
| Water Extraction | $1,000 – $5,000 | The amount of water that needs to be extracted, the difficulty of the job, and the local conditions in your neighborhood. |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$500 – $2,000 | The size of the affected area, the type of equipment needed, and the local conditions in your neighborhood. |
| Mold Remediation | $1,000 – $5,000 | The size of the affected area, the type of mold, and the local conditions in your neighborhood. |
| Waterproofing and Drainage Solutions | $1,000 – $5,000 | The size of the affected area, the type of solution needed, and the local conditions in your neighborhood. |
